The News Minute | November 28, 2014 | 3:15 pm IST Two new pocket-sized drones have made their debut on the crowd-funding website Kickstarter. Anura - which shrinks to a phone-sized package with retractable wings - and the Zano - an intelligent and autonomous drone - are now seeking funds for mass production. Anura is the size of an average iphone, but a little thicker. It has four retractable wings which can be tucked into the package and then carried around without a box. With a flight time of about 10 minutes, it connects to the controller through Wi-Fi. The drone also streams video and images back to the smartphone to capture and stream live video. On the other side, Zano is slightly smaller and looks more like a conventional drone. It claims a slightly longer flight time of 10-15 minutes though it does need a case to carry around because of the exposed propellers. Both the drones have built-in cameras to shoot still images and high-definition video. The drones can be controlled via apps for android and iOS mobile devices, the information available on Kickstarter read. With IANS
